Abstract
The present invention is a novel and improved method and apparatus for performing position location in wireless communications system. One embodiment of the invention comprises a method for performing position location on a subscriber unit in a terrestrial wireless telephone system using a set of satellites each transmitting a signal, the terrestrial wireless telephone system having base stations, including the steps of transmitting an aiding message from the base station to the subscriber unit, said aiding message containing information regarding a data boundary for each signal from the set of satellites, applying correlation codes to each signal yielding corresponding correlation data and accumulating said correlation data over an first interval preceding a corresponding data boundary yielding a first accumulation result, and a second interval following said corresponding data boundary yielding a second accumulation result.

8. A tangible data storage medium comprising executable data capable of causing a programmable device to perform the steps of:
-
(a) receiving a first signal having at least one data boundary from an external source;
(b) receiving from a second source a second signal an aiding message containing information regarding at least one of the data boundaries within the first signal;
applying correlation codes to the first signal to yield correlation data;
accumulating the correlation data yielded by applying the correlation codes over a first interval preceding a first one of the data boundaries for which information was received from the second source yielding a first accumulation result; and
(c) accumulating the correlation data over a second interval following the first one of the data boundaries for which information was received from the second source yielding a second accumulation result, the timing of the first and second interval being based upon the knowledge of the timing of the at least one data boundary ascertained from the aiding message.
